JONAS ØGLÆND HOLDING AS is registered as a limited company in Lillehammer, Innlandet with organisation number 937577265. The business is classified under rental and operating of own or leased real estate (NACE 68.200). The company was incorporated in 1985. Registered share capital is NOK 100,000, divided into 200 shares. The company's stated purpose is: “Drive forretning, eiendomsdrift og annen økonomisk virksomhet, herunder være deltaker i andre selskaper med slikt formål.”. The most recent filed accounts, for the 2025 financial year, show NOK 127,000 in revenue and NOK 104,000 in operating profit.
